There have been free outdoor movies offered in Kansas City for a long time (I'm looking at you, Crown Center) but this summer will see an explosion in the number of different locations for free outdoor family movies.
Most of the outdoor films are in parks or parking lots - so bring your own lawn chairs and blankets. Many locations have concessions - but not all of them. So, pack a few drinks and snacks for the crew before you go (my guess is that most of these spots prohibit alcohol for liability reasons).
Be sure to check out the website of each program for more information. Many of these outdoor cinema showings have a free concert or kids' activities going on before the show. Crown Center even has fireworks!
